the general equation of a line is

where m is the slope and b the y-intercept
we can notice the y-intercept on the graph, is 12, because is the coordinate were x=0 or were the line touch the y-axis
now we need to find the slope, ussing

where (x2,y2) is a rigth point from (x1,y1), I can take any point of the line, for this case I will use (0,12) and (2,15)
where (2,15) is a right point from (0,12)
so, replacing

the slope is 3/2
now I can replace on the general equation ussing b=12 and m=3/2
